Sitescape² is the core technology used in a wide range of analogue and digital security and surveillance management solutions from the World leader in digital CCTV development and integrated security systems, IES Digital Systems.
The latest in a 12-year line of thoroughbred digital recording systems, Sitescape² takes you to the cutting edge of technology and provides the power, flexibility and low cost that makes it today’s leading digital CCTV solution.
Retaining the intuitive simplicity of the renowned SiteScape user interface, Sitescape² offers the ultimate in high performance and flexibility with a powerful programming interface that is instrumental in building complex and integrated security and surveillance solutions. With full digital networking capabilities and scalable architecture, Sitescape² has been designed to grow with your ongoing security requirements.
IES has a proven track record in producing dedicated digital surveillance systems for use in networked and stand alone applications. The new Sitescape² range sees the introduction of fully featured products available in software-only and mobile application formats. Recognising the advantages of a fully flexible product range, Sitescape² is designed to allow seamless upgrade and expansion, whether you start with entry-level application software or a fully networked system.
Sitescape² for mobile applications gives a choice of storage media and a choice of local image download or remote live viewing via high-speed cellular data networks. It is the ideal solution for use in a variety of public transport applications including buses, trams and trains and also ‘cash in transit’ vehicle applications. The Sitescape² mobile solution is equally well suited in remote surveillance applications such as building sites, historic monuments, pipelines and any unattended sites where fixed telephony is not available.
Of course, Sitescape² is available in stand-alone and rack-mounted network formats and is now able to record from 50 up to 400 pictures per second enabling simultaneous live recording from any number of cameras.
